The Pennsylvania State Police, Troop G, Lewistown Station continue
their investigation of a Burglary that occurred in Mifflin County.
Sometime between November 12 and 13, 2008, three residences in Oliver
Township, Mifflin County, Pennsylvania, were broken into. The
suspect(s) ransacked the homes, damaging several items while
there. Higher priced items were passed up; with the suspect(s)
taking cash and smaller items that could be easily carried.
Entire sets of baseball cards from 1971 – 1975 were taken along
with silver certificates.
Two cars were seen in the area around the time of the burglaries.
One car was a light blue Ford Crown Victoria with a single male
occupant. The second car was a red or maroon Toyota Camry or
Corolla with three occupants, all believed to be male.
